The unlimited warbirds final is the "main event" usually on the Sunday.

Without question, The best air race action is the unlimited gold final on Sunday afternoon. Normally happens around 4 PM give or take. Reno national championship Air Races are great. I have been every year since the 70's. With the diffrent classes of racing and some of the best aerobatics, plus military and static display, it won't dissappoint. Google national championship air races for the offical web site. If you stay in reno they have bus service from most of the hotels. worth the money as traffic is pretty bad Sat and Sun and busses get a special route. Parking is not free so the few bucks the bus costs is well worth it.

I have gone all four days many times in the past. If you plan 2 days, do one day in the stands and spend the cash and get a pit pass and walk around the other day. Traffic is really bad on Sun, so do not plan on getting out of there quickly, either hang oput a while or plan another day. Jump seats are usually tight in and out of Reno and Sacramento is much easier. The final Sun race comes down to who is still in the race (mech) and can be a blow out some years. Have fun!
